1. Define Your Website’s Needs and Goals

The first step to saving money on custom web development is to clearly define what you need. A well-defined project will help you avoid unnecessary costs by ensuring that you’re only paying for the features and functionality you truly need.

Start by outlining the goals of your website. Do you need a simple brochure site, an e-commerce store, or a more complex platform with custom features? Once you know your goals, break them down into must-have and nice-to-have features. This will allow you to prioritize what’s essential and avoid paying for features you don’t need.

2. Choose the Right Web Development Team

Finding the right web development team is crucial for ensuring both quality and cost-efficiency. You want to work with professionals who understand your needs and can deliver results within your budget.

When searching for custom web development services, consider looking for experienced freelancers or small agencies. Larger agencies tend to have higher rates due to overhead costs, but freelancers or smaller firms may offer more competitive pricing. Be sure to check their portfolio and client testimonials to ensure they have the experience and expertise needed to handle your project.

Another way to save money is by hiring a developer who specializes in the specific type of website you want. For example, if you’re building an e-commerce site, look for a developer who specializes in e-commerce platforms like Shopify, WooCommerce, or Magento. Specialization often leads to more efficient development, which can help lower costs.

3. Use Pre-Built Templates and Themes

One of the easiest ways to save on web development costs is by using pre-built templates or themes. While custom design is often the best route for businesses with unique branding, pre-built templates can be a cost-effective option for homeowners or small businesses who are looking to save money.

Many modern website builders, like WordPress, offer a wide selection of customizable themes that can give your site a professional look without the need for custom design work. These themes often come with all the necessary features, such as mobile responsiveness and SEO optimization, built-in.

Of course, you can still add custom touches to the design, such as updating colors, logos, and fonts. This allows you to maintain a personalized feel for your website while keeping costs down.

4. Start with a Minimalistic Approach

When building a custom website, it’s tempting to include every feature and design element you can think of. However, the more complex your website, the higher the cost will be. Starting with a minimalistic approach can help you save money while still creating a functional and user-friendly site.

Focus on the core elements that will help your website achieve its goals. This could include a simple homepage, an about page, and a contact form. You can always add more features later on as your business grows or your budget allows.

Additionally, consider using a content management system (CMS) like WordPress, which makes it easier to manage and update your website without needing ongoing development work.

5. Communicate Your Budget Clearly

Be upfront with your web developer about your budget from the beginning. A good developer will be able to suggest solutions that fit within your financial constraints while still delivering a high-quality website. They may even offer alternatives to expensive custom features, such as integrating third-party tools or using open-source solutions.

By being transparent about your budget, you can avoid unexpected costs down the road and ensure that your developer prioritizes cost-effective options.

6. Avoid Overly Complex Features

While custom features can make your website unique, they can also drive up the cost of development. Certain features, like advanced animations, custom content management systems, or complex integrations, can be time-consuming and expensive to implement.

Instead of opting for complex features, consider simpler alternatives that achieve the same goal. For instance, if you want a unique design, focus on custom graphics and branding elements rather than custom-built interactive features. This will help keep your website simple yet attractive and functional.

7. Leverage Open Source Software

Open-source software is a fantastic way to save money on custom web development services without compromising quality. These are software solutions that are freely available and can be customized to meet your needs.

Popular open-source platforms like WordPress, Joomla, and Drupal are highly customizable and come with a large selection of plugins and themes that can save you both time and money. Open-source tools also have strong community support, so you can find plenty of resources to help you build your website without needing to pay for expensive custom software.

8. Invest in Quality Hosting

While cutting costs on development is important, don’t skimp on web hosting. Good hosting is essential for keeping your website running smoothly and efficiently. Slow load times or frequent downtime can hurt your user experience and affect your search engine rankings.

Investing in quality web hosting can help you avoid issues down the line. Look for hosting providers that offer good performance, security, and customer support at a reasonable price. Managed hosting services like SiteGround or Bluehost can provide additional support, ensuring your website stays up and running without the need for constant maintenance.

9. Plan for Long-Term Maintenance

Web development isn’t a one-time project – websites require ongoing maintenance to stay secure, functional, and up-to-date. However, you don’t need to pay for costly maintenance services if you plan ahead.

When working with a developer, ask about the possibility of training you or your team to manage basic tasks, such as content updates, minor design changes, or plugin updates. This way, you can handle routine maintenance without relying on a developer for every small change.

10. Seek Recommendations and Reviews

When choosing a web developer, don’t just go with the first option you find. Ask for recommendations from other homeowners or business owners who have gone through the process of custom web development. You can also check online reviews and ratings to get an idea of the developer’s reputation and quality of work.

Word-of-mouth referrals are often the best way to find reliable and affordable web developers who are experienced and trustworthy.
